首页 新闻 赞助 找找看

单例模式的适用性的疑问?

0
[已解决问题] 解决于 2013-06-11 20:47

单例模式的适用性:

1.当类只能有一个实例而且客户可以从一个众所周知的访问点访问它时。

2.当这个唯一实例应该是通过子类化可扩展的,并且客户应该无需更改代码就能使用一个扩展的实例时。

第二条是什么意思啊??

tomgu1991的主页 tomgu1991 | 初学一级 | 园豆:161
提问于:2013-06-03 15:15
< >
分享
最佳答案
0

意思应该就是扩展类还是原来类的实例。不要想多了,有没第二点都一样。

奖励园豆:5
阿龍 | 菜鸟二级 |园豆:268 | 2013-06-03 17:16

您说的我没大懂,您能不能帮忙举个情景或者举个例子符合第二条啊,小弟在此谢过了~~

tomgu1991 | 园豆:161 (初学一级) | 2013-06-03 18:51

@tomgu1991: 适用性: 1. 系统只需要一个实例对象

                                  2.客户调用类的单个实例只允许使用一个公共访问点

阿龍 | 园豆:268 (菜鸟二级) | 2013-06-07 09:31

@阿龍: 虽然答非所问,还是谢谢你了

tomgu1991 | 园豆:161 (初学一级) | 2013-06-11 20:46
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册